Transaction 5599d91cba2fcab6331f2d105a3611c999f1bdc8b91a76708dfccfa8551520f6
1 Input
1 Output
-
5599d91cba2fcab6331f2d105a3611c999f1bdc8b91a76708dfccfa8551520f6:0
- value
- 266030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1dd69a77232007d37b81e1df98e5eb6dcef57bb OP_EQUAL
- address
- 3NHHCjKacQVXbjf5iGXB8RkEn9vMzKpP8r